by Judith B. Tablan

Tangub City (11 September) — The City has lined up activities that will culminate in the celebration of the city fiesta on September 29, in honor of St. Michael the Archangel.

September 1 to 7 is the celebration of 15th National Crime Prevention Week. The celebration will start with a motorcade at 7:00 to 8:00 A.M.

A five-minute whistle and horn blowing will be participated in by elementary, secondary and tertiary schools in the city.

This will be followed in by Talakayan sa Radyo ng Bayan over local radio station DXJT. Panelists are department heads of the City Social Welfare and Development, City Prosecutor, Regional Trial Court, City Probation, City Council”s Office, the Philippine Army and non government organizations.

On September 2 to 7 is the on-air awareness drive on crime and drug abuse which is spearheaded by the Philippine National Police.

September 4 is scheduled for Poster Making and Essay writing contests to be participated in by the high school and college students respectively in Tangub City.

September 5 is scheduled for Family Tree Planting along Sta. Maria-Hoyohoy road.

September 6 is Alay-Lakad and formal presentation of the candidates for Miss Tangub City Tourism 2009.

September 12 is Sangguniang Kabataan (SK) Day.

The following day is SK sportsfest day and pictorial of the candidates for Miss Tangub Tourism 2009, which is also the prejudging for the special awards.

September 14 to17 is the Civil Service Week celebration.

Day 1 of the celebration is scheduled for marathon, parade and overview on healthy life style. This is also the start of the games.

Day 2 (Sept 15) is scheduled for blood sugar testing, blood typing and blood pressure taking, bloodletting and hataw.

Games continue up to the end of the four-day celebration.

September 17 is pictorial (studio shots) of the candidates.

The Department of Education, Tangub City Division, scheduled its city meet on September 18 to 19. This is also scheduled for candidates” location shooting.

Briefing of contingents for the Dalit Festival (invitational category) falls on September 18.

Fashion shoot for candidates is scheduled on September 20, while the Talent Night falls on the following day.

Cultural Night, a folk dance contest participated in by clustered agencies of the national and local offices, is set on September 22.

The City Social Welfare and Development marked September 23 for Family Day.

Dress rehearsal of candidates falls on September 24.

The Search for Miss Tangub City Tourism is on September 25.

Motocross competition falls on September 25-26. (City Information Office)
